De rooie rat is failliet, u kunt niet meer bestellen. ISBN: 9781781685914 Taal: Engels Jaar: 2014 europaWhat was "Creative Britain"? Was it the "golden age" that Tony Blair
vaunted in 2007, or a neoliberal nirvana? In the twenty-first century,
culture-the visual and performing arts, museums and galleries, the
creative industries -have become ever more important to governments,
to the economy, and to how people live. Cultural historian Robert
Hewison shows how, from Cool Britannia and the Millennium Dome
to the Olympics and beyond, Creative Britain rose from the desert of
Thatcherism only to fall into the slough of New Labour's managerialism
